New Frontiers Agricultural Hall to host Sweet Success Celebration
Thu, 21 Jul 2022 10:30:36 CDT
Oklahoma State University will host a Sweet Success Celebration for the New Frontiers Agricultural Hall. Officials announced July 13 that OSU surpassed the $50 million fundraising goal for the New Frontiers Agricultural Hall with the generosity of more than 600 donors. The milestone comes two and a half years after publicly launching the campaign, which will help build a state-of-the-art teaching, research and Extension facility for OSU Agriculture. The new building is expected to open in fall 2024. Event speakers include OSU President Kayse Shrum; OSU Foundation President Blaire Atkinson; and Thomas G. Coon, vice president for OSU Agriculture and dean of the Ferguson College of Agriculture.
